Output 8c26d930ae96fecd212ba301d48e2486a60530fabdf7fd6577547477d64521cb:5

value
2352067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6342d10cef218c3d2bb95e842504a467aa659c69 OP_EQUAL
address
3Ajrs2vY7WZ7gpBCZiqCb5GPzDsRJbnaXe
transaction
8c26d930ae96fecd212ba301d48e2486a60530fabdf7fd6577547477d64521cb
confirmations
466586
spent
true